Our team of clinical nurse facilitators, clinical psychologists, exercise physiologists and dietitians offer individual support and education to help you manage your chronic pain. Our Persistent Pain Program (PPP) can help with pain associated with surgery, trauma or other conditions.
Where is it available?
360’s Persistent Pain Program is based in Rockingham. It involves monthly education sessions for six months, plus individual case management for up to 12 months.
How do I access the Persistent Pain Program?
The Persistent Pain Program is available via GP referral. If you do not have a GP, please contact us directly. Eligible participants may also be entitled to three subsidised supplementary allied health services to help with managing persistent pain. Eligibility is determined during individual appointments so contact us to find out more.
